Polish presidential candidates face off in debate
Published in Saudi Press Agency on 27 - 06 - 2010


Poland's two presidential candidates faced off in
their first one-on-one debate Sunday night in the elections to find a
successor for Lech Kaczynski, who died in a plane crash in Russia in
April, according to dpa.
Bronislaw Komorowski of the centre-right Civic Platform party
stressed Poland's need to play a stronger role in the European Union
and was more liberal on social issues. Komorowski had received some
41 per cent of the vote in the first round of voting on June 20.
Jaroslaw Kaczynski, of the right-wing Law and Justice party, was
more hesitant to build relations with Russia and emphasized
traditional values. Kaczynski, the identical twin brother of deceased
President Lech, had received some 36 per cent of the vote in the
first round.
Poles will vote in a runoff on July 4 as there was no majority
winner in the first round.
The debate on Sunday - broadcast on five news channels in Poland -
centered on three topics: foreign policy, the economy and domestic
issues.
Kaczynski was more conservative on social issues, saying when it
came to in-vitro fertilization that he was a "Catholic who thinks an
embryo is a person."
Komorowski replied that, "everyone must decide in their conscience
whether to reach for this method."
There has been a heated debate in Poland, which is largely Roman
Catholic, on whether the public health care system should pay for in-
vitro fertilization.
Kaczynski's brother died in the crash on April 10 in Smolensk,
Russia, that also killed his wife and 94 other politicians and
military brass.
Kaczynski said he has always supported asking the Russian side to
turn the investigation of the plane crash over to Poland. Kaczynski
said the current situation was "unsatisfactory" with Russia and
Poland cooperating on separate probes into the crash.
Komorowski said there was a need to move into
the future in relations with Russia, with programs like cultural
events and youth exchanges.
The debate was tense with both candidates at times going over
their time limits or talking over each other. The candidates shook
hands after the hour-long debate and quickly left the studio.
A survey conducted on TVN 24's website after the debate showed 67
per cent of respondents believing Komorowski had won the debate. Some
26 per cent said Kaczynski won in the survey of some 64,000
respondents.
